Updating pod address ranges and pools using scripts


BMC Network Automation provides a BeanShell script library that is used to update address ranges and address pools in network pods. This topic describes the following scripts:

To use any of these scripts, copy them from /opt/bmc/bca-networks/public/bmc/bca-networks/csm/bsh to /opt/bmc/bca-networks/tools and run them from the /tools directory. These scripts run in a BSH shell, and that type of shell is only available in the /tools directory.
